2002 Holden Vectra vs. 1982 Renault 9

To start off, 2002 Holden Vectra is newer by 20 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1982 Renault 9.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1982 Renault 9 would be higher. At 3,175 cc (6 cylinders), 2002 Holden Vectra is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2002 Holden Vectra (209 HP @ 6200 RPM) has 150 more horse power than 1982 Renault 9. (59 HP @ 5250 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2002 Holden Vectra should accelerate faster than 1982 Renault 9.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2002 Holden Vectra weights approximately 655 kg more than 1982 Renault 9.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2002 Holden Vectra (300 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 200 more torque (in Nm) than 1982 Renault 9. (100 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2002 Holden Vectra will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1982 Renault 9.
